Browsers limit how much RAM a single tab can use. If your game crashes after an hour of play, close other heavy background tabs (like video streaming or social media feeds) and restart the Eaglercraft tab to completely refresh the allocated system memory. The client is known to work on browsers as old as on Windows XP. It supports both WebGL 1.0 and WebGL 2.0 , though advanced visual features require WebGL 2.0.
